		<description>well, i work as a manager in T-Mobile engineering and operations.  I also happened to be on the team that turned it up in my market.  No one really knows it on due to there only be on T1.  So tell me how you flip a switch a get 7.2 Mb/s out a 1.5Mb/s T1?  Unless there is some new math out there, you need more than one T1.  Only a few towers needing upgrades for HSPA+? My area has over 200 NodeBs.  Every one of those that will become HSPA+ will need system module replacments for the new transport equipment.  The new transport alone is a huge project.  Whatever you think you know about this project, you don&#039;t.</description>
